Why Coherent Matters in Quantum

Quantum technology isn’t just about exotic cryogenic chips and complex algorithms—it’s also about the precision tools needed to manipulate light, atoms, and particles at the smallest scales. That’s where Coherent’s decades-long leadership in lasers, optics, and photonics comes in.

Here’s how COHR fits into the quantum equation:

1. Lasers for Quantum Computing

Many quantum systems—especially ion-trap and photonic quantum computers—require extremely stable and tunable lasers to control and read qubits. Coherent produces these high-performance laser systems, designed to deliver the stability and precision that quantum experiments demand.

2. Photonics for Quantum Communication

Quantum communication relies on transmitting single photons or entangled particles over fiber or free space. Coherent’s specialty optical fibers, photonic components, and optical networking technology are directly applicable to quantum key distribution (QKD) and other secure communications protocols that use quantum principles.

3. Advanced Optics for Quantum Sensing

Quantum sensors can detect gravitational changes, magnetic fields, and other environmental factors with extreme precision. Coherent’s custom optics and photonics modules enable these next-gen sensing devices, which have applications in defense, aerospace, and geophysics.

4. Research Partnerships

Coherent has supplied equipment to national labs, universities, and private quantum startups, supporting experiments in photonic qubits, quantum entanglement, and precision measurement systems. This positions them as an “arms supplier” in the quantum race rather than a direct quantum computer manufacturer.

The “Pick-and-Shovel” Play in Quantum

While COHR isn’t making quantum processors, their technologies are foundational to those who are. In investing terms, Coherent is a “pick-and-shovel” play—selling the tools and infrastructure that quantum companies depend on. This means they can benefit from quantum growth across multiple verticals without betting on any single hardware architecture.
